The last one is a timeline I haven't seen udpated since long ago... It was called Britons Triumphant. At the start, the timeline based itself on a possibility of King Arthur's existence being the reason the Anglo-Saxon invasion stopped for 20 years. This taken, the POD was having Arthur survive the Battle of Calamn instead of dying. The King would then move on to unite OTL England and Wales into a Kingdom of Britannia.
This timeline had a cool concept and interesting butterflies (The Carolingian Dynasty not being overthrown by the Capet in France, Aquitaine declaring itself as an independant Kingdom, No schism between the West and the East, A unified Italy, etc...). I thus think seeing it adapted would be quite great and have some success. Unfortunately, it hasn't been udpated in a very long time and it is stuck in the 1200s or so...

To specify : I'd imagine a potential SotS game as being sort of a hybrid of tower defense and co-op FPS - something similar to Iron Grip : Warlord. You'd have a small band of soldiers (say, a maximum of twenty) and you'd have to endure insane last stands against attacking hordes of Grex. :cool: Being tower defense, you'd be given some time to set up makeshift defences after the start of each level. However, you wouldn't just purchase them, you'd have to use a simple physics-based manipulation system to build barricades and traps (etc.) with your character's "own hands". Then the attack would begin, you'd grab your guns and start kicking Grex arse. :D The game would be a more squad-based shooter and you'd have to carefully ration your explosives and ammo. Melee weapons would be invaluable - not just emergency weapons, but effective anti-Grex sidearms (plus, they don't need ammo). There wouldn't be any restrictive "class" specialization - anyone could wield a rifle, machine gun, flamethrower, etc. And there'd be lots of various maps to play on, each with its own unique challenges : Defend the town hall in the war-torn hellscape of Brussels; hold the Sydney lines until all evacuation trains have safely escaped; protect artillery positions in the frozen winter forests of the Urals; traverse the deadly cliffs, ledges, summits and caves of heavily infested Bryce Canyon in Utah; etc. :D Most maps would have mannable stationary guns and some even drivable vehicles. There'd also be some element of squad morale : If it would get too low, one (or more) of your squadmates would be overcomed by despair, then start panicking or having defeatist thoughts. You could raze morale by barking something encouraging or threatening at the frightened soldiers... or just shooting them in the head. :D ;) Besides these common missions, there would also be "breather levels" - say, having fun as a gunner aboard a Luftkreuzer or biplane, shooting those pesky flying Grex. :p
